The most obvious benefit is the elimination of physical media. If your synthesizer or sampler relies on an SD card for samples or patches, you typically have to eject the card, put it in a card reader, transfer files, and re-insert it. With Midiplex running an FTP server, the Pico sits between your computer (or phone) and the storage device. You can drag and drop samples wirelessly from your couch without touching the hardware.
